Triangles-Classified by Sides Equilateral Triangle 3 Congruent Sides Isosceles Triangle At least 2 congruent sides Scalene Triangle No congruent Sides Triangles Classified by Angles Acute Triangle All angles acute Right Triangle 1 Right Angle Equiangular 3 congruent angles Obtuse Triangle 1 Obtuse Angle Ex. 1 Classify the Triangle Ex. 2 Classify the Triangle Parts of a Triangle Vertex:3 Points joining the sides of a triangle Points A, B and C are the vertices of the triangle to the right B A C Parts of a right triangle Legs: The sides that form the right angle Hypotenuse: The side opposite of the right angle hypotenuse leg leg Parts of an Isosceles Triangle Legs: The two congruent sides Base: The third remaining side leg leg base Interior Angles Exterior Angles Triangle Sum Theorem The sum of the measures of the interior angles of a triangle is 180⁰ m A m B m C 180 B A C Ex. 3 Find x Ex. 4 Find x Exterior Angle Theorem The measure of an exterior angle of a triangle is equal to the sum of the measures of the two nonadjacent interior angles B m 1 m A m B 1 A C Ex. 5 Find x
